    • Pulled vehicle into service bay for customer concern of check engine and vehicle not starting/ running bad after getting gas. With vehicle in service bay scanned for codes and found one code P0496 Evap emissions system flow during non purge indicating purge solenoid has gone bad. Removed connector and evap hose from purge solenoid then started vehicle found vacuum at the purge solenoid at all times confirming it has failed recommend replacement of purge solenoid and retest.

  • 2012 Chevrolet Colorado

    Chevrolet Colorado
    Mileage
    211,029
    Service Date
    3/20/2026
    Services Performed
    • ran and test drove vehicle, confirm lack of power, with vehicle in service bay, scan for codes, has one code for 2nd air for incorrect flow, removed O2 sensor and back pressure tested, has close to 10 PSI of back pressure when vehicle is rev up, removed rear O2 sensor and checked pressure, same results, should be close to 0PSI inspected Exhaust system, confirm front cat looks to been replaced, 2nd cat plug,(Rear Cat after rear O2 sensor) Recommend 2nd cat
    • ran and test drove vehicle, confirm Coolant temperature gauge not working as design, with scan tool perform gauge sweep, needle goes way pass hot mark, stepper motor not working as design Recommend cluster stepper motors,
    • ran and test drove vehicle, unable to duplicate problem at this time, found after driving with 4X4 and switch to 2X4 the front actuator on Diff sticking at times, checked fluid level and condition, found transfer case low on fluid, condition of fluid is normal, see no unusual problem at this time, Recommend top off fluid,

  • 2019 Chevrolet Suburban

    Chevrolet Suburban
    Mileage
    133,175
    Service Date
    2/20/2026
    Services Performed
    • check engine light on , code scan performed and got a p0796 pressure control solenoid valve 3 stuck off.. check transmission oil level and condition and the oil is burnt .. no forward or reverse,, a transmission is needed
    • REMOVED DRIVE SHAFTS, REMOVED T-CASE, DROPPED TRANSMISSION, INSTALLED NEW TRANSMISSION IN REV ORDER, TORQUED ALL FASTENER TO SPEC, PROGRAMMED NEW TRANSMISSION ASSY. FILLED TRANSMISSION, LET RUN IN BAY SHIFTING THROUGH GEARS, TOPPED OFF TRANSMISSION TOOK FOR TEST DRIVE, INSPECTED FOR LEAKS, NONE FOUND AT THIS TIME. WILL BE DUE FOR FRONT BRAKES IN NEXT COUPLE OIL CHANGES MEASURE AT ABOUT 3MM
